Great sticks for the price however I ordered the 5B and they are the same size as 2B's. I might have to order 5A's next time to get a 5B like size. They must run big or something.

Used to use 5ANs for along time, but they started feeling too thin and light, also had more drops. Bought a pair of 2B nylon and a pair of 2B wood tips from a bulk bucket at my local store. I really wasn't expecting much since they were so cheap. These two pair have lasted well over a year beating the heck out of rubber e-drums. On the main pair, the varnish has started wearing thin, but they're over a year old!
